Original Advert
The Contract Specialist will be responsible for study level contract management, including but not limited to Clinical Study Agreement, Clinical Research Coordinator Agreement and other required agreements mandatory for site activation, as well as their relevant amendments. This role will take advantage of Astra Zeneca contract system platform to play a key role during study site start-up stage by driving the contract process, while in the meantime act within the study team as the primary contact point for contract issue including contract quality.
Typical Accountabilities
- Assist in contract preparation. Collect, review and complete the contract required information.
- Manage budget grid in the contract. Ensure the cost calculation are in line with the study protocol, as well as agreed with site.
- Monitor the regular contract progress and report if any issue finding.
- Responsible for contract system maintenance and daily support to internal team.
- Facilitate the contract related training to study team and issue resolution.
- Initiate and drive contract internal review and approval process.
- Other tasks assigned by line manager.
